> foo2zjs open-source printer driver provides support for many old (2004-2012 
> era) printers, including selected HP LaserJet models.
> These printers require the firmware which needs to be uploaded to the printer 
> on every power on.
>
> Firmware files are not bundled in foo2zjs. The upstream includes the script 
> called `getweb` which downloads the firmware files from third-party websites 
> and unpacks them.
> `getweb` is not packaged in Fedora's foo2zjs, which makes HP LaserJets unable 
> to print.
>
> Other source of the firmware files are proprietary hp-plugin packages which 
> are downloaded by `hplip` package.
> I've changed the script (`getweb-hpplugin`) to download hp-plugin bundles and 
> use files from there.
>
> hp-plugin downloads is packaged in Fedora's hplip package.
>
> The questions are:
> - Can Fedora include `getweb`, which downloads the firmware files from 
> elsewhere?
> - If not, can Fedora include `getweb-hpplugin`, which downloads HP plugin 
> files from official openprinting website and extracts firmware from these, as 
> does HP's hplip?

What is the distinction between `getweb` and `getweb-plugin` - is it
that `getweb-plugin` downloads a subset of the firmware files that are
downloaded by `getweb` (which I guess you are assuming are okay
because `hplip` is already packaged in Fedora)?
